Blackburn Rovers have made a bid for highly-rated Colchester United defender Junior Tchamadeu, TEAMtalk understands.

Tchamadeu, 19, is regarded as one of the best young prospects in the Football League after catching the eye for Colchester over the last couple of seasons. Tchamadeu was crowned Sky Bet League Two Young Player of the Season at the recent EFL awards and was also named in the League Two Team of the Year.

The attacking wing-back, who mainly plays on the right flank, also swept the boards at Colchester’s end of season awards having made 46 appearances in all competitions and chipping in with five goals and two assists.

Blackburn have held a long-term interest in Tchamadeu, having tried to sign the defender in January, and they are moving quickly this summer to try and land the teenager to fend off potential interest from rival clubs.

Colchester are aware of the growing interest in Tchamadeu and accept they are facing a battle to keep hold of the defender this summer.

The U’s academy product, who also spent time at Charlton Athletic as a youngster, is entering the final year of his contract with Colchester and Blackburn are aiming to tie up a deal for the player as soon as possible.

Blackburn missed out on the Championship play-offs on goal difference and Rovers boss Jon Dahl Tomasson is determined to build a squad this summer capable of challenging again for promotion back to the Premier League next season.

While Tchamadeu could arrive at Ewood Park this summer, Tomasson will have to do without influential attacker Ben Brereton Diaz. The England-born Chile international is understood to have reached a pre-contract agreement with Villarreal ahead of a free transfer to La Liga, with his Blackburn terms expiring at the end of June.
